Standards we work with

CODEX CAC/GL 24-1997

Codex Alimentarius — CAC/GL 24-1997

The international “General Guidelines for Use of the Term Halal” issued by the Codex Alimentarius Commission (FAO/WHO). It is the global baseline reference for using the word “halal” on food and defines lawful and unlawful sources and slaughter according to Islamic law.

GSO 2055-1

GSO 2055-1 — Halal Food, Part 1: General Requirements

The Gulf (GSO) standard for halal food covering the entire supply chain: ingredients, processing, packaging, storage and transport.

GSO 993

GSO 993 — Animal Slaughtering Requirements According to Islamic Rules

The Gulf standard specifying halal slaughtering requirements for meat and poultry, including stunning rules, slaughterman requirements and hygiene.

OIC/SMIIC 1

OIC/SMIIC 1 — General Requirements for Halal Food

The standard of the Organization of Islamic Cooperation's standards institute (SMIIC), adopted by many OIC member countries including Türkiye.

MS 1500

MS 1500 — Halal Food (Malaysia)

Malaysia's halal standard for the production, preparation, handling and storage of food, applied by JAKIM.

HAS 23000

HAS 23000 — Halal Assurance System (Indonesia)

Indonesia's halal assurance system criteria (MUI / BPJPH). Halal certification is mandatory for most products sold in Indonesia.

UAE.S 2055-1

UAE.S 2055-1 — Halal Products (UAE)

The Emirati technical regulation for halal products applied within the UAE national halal mark scheme.
